At the University of Guelph, diversity, equity and inclusion matter. They are core values at U of G and are fundamental to who we are and what we do.

To help us create a better understanding of employment diversity at U of G, all faculty and staff are required to complete the University’s Diversity Matters survey. Access your unique, confidential survey through https://uoguel.ph/diversitymatters.

Whether you identify with an under-represented group or not, your participation is required. All faculty and staff are asked to complete the survey’s first question, indicating their choice to participate or not, and then choose whether they will complete the remainder of the survey.

U of G’s Diversity Matters survey:

  • Is confidential
  • Contains six short questions
  • Gives you the opportunity to self-identify with any of five under-represented groups: women, Aboriginal peoples, persons with disabilities, members of visible minorities and members of the LGBTQ+ community
  • Takes only a few minutes to complete
  • Gives you the option to decline some or all of the survey questions
  • Helps U of G meet federal requirements on diversity reporting
